How Do I Export a Figma Photo?

Last updated on September 29, 2022 @ 10:16 am

We all know how to take a screenshot on our computers, but what if you want to take a high-quality image of your Figma project? That’s where exporting comes in!

In this article, we’ll show you how to export a Figma photo so that it looks great no matter where you use it.

First, open your Figma project and select the element that you want to export. Then, click on the “Export” button in the top-right corner of the screen.

PRO TIP: When exporting a Figma photo, be sure to use the highest quality settings possible to avoid losing image quality.

In the Export window, select the “PNG” option from the “Format” drop-down menu. You can also choose to export as a JPG or GIF, but PNG is usually the best choice for photos.

Next, decide whether you want to export the entire element or just a portion of it. If you only need to export part of the element, select the “Use artboards” option and then click on the area that you want to export.

Finally, click on the “Export” button and choose where you want to save the image. That’s all there is to it!
